基于RFID技術的身份識別系統(tǒng)設計與實現(xiàn)
引言
RFID是RadioFrequencyIdentification的縮寫,即射頻識別技術[1],俗稱電子標簽。RFID射頻識別是一種非接觸式的自動識別技術[2-3],它通過射頻信號自動識別目標對象并獲取相關數據,識別工作無須人工干預,可工作于各種惡劣環(huán)境。RFID技術可識別高速運動物體并可同時識別多個標簽,操作快捷方便。
埃森哲實驗室首席科學家弗格森認為RFID是一種突破性的技術:“第一,可以識別單個的非常具體的物體,而不是象條形碼那樣只能識別一類物體;第二,其采用無線電射頻,可以透過外部材料讀取數據,而條形碼必須靠激光來讀取信息;第三,可以同時對多個物體進行識讀,而條形碼只能一個一個地讀。此外,存儲的信息也非常大。”
基于此,我們開發(fā)了一個無線身份識別系統(tǒng),用于對進出房間者進行身份識別和數據統(tǒng)計。
1RFID系統(tǒng)的基本組成及特點
1.1RFID系統(tǒng)的基本組成
最基本的RFID系統(tǒng)由電子標簽(Tag)、閱讀器(Reader)和天線(Antenna)三部分組成[4-5]。如圖1所示。
圖1RFID射頻識別系統(tǒng)基本組成部分
電子標簽:電子標簽也稱作智能標簽,它是指由IC芯片和無線通信天線組成的超微型的小標簽,其內置的射頻天線用于和閱讀器進行通信。由耦合元件及芯片組成,每個標簽具有唯一的電子編碼(EPC),附著在要標識的目標物體上。閱讀器:閱讀器又稱讀頭、讀寫器等,它在RFID系統(tǒng)中扮演著重要的角色,主要負責與電子標簽的雙向通信,同時接受來自主機系統(tǒng)的控制指令。閱讀器的頻率決定了RFID系統(tǒng)工作的頻段,其功率決定了身頻識別的有效距離。閱讀器根據使用的結構和技術不同可以是讀或讀/寫裝置,是RFID系統(tǒng)信息控制和處理中心。閱讀器通常由射頻接口、邏輯控制單元和天線3部分組成。
1.2RFID系統(tǒng)的特點與優(yōu)勢
RFID技術的應用包羅萬象,是近幾年來信息技術領域最熱門的話題之一。RFID技術較多應用于物流行業(yè)。傳統(tǒng)的物流信息采集工作方式是通過人工將貨物進行核對并將數據輸入到計算機中。這一過程費時費力,并且可能由于人為過失造成數據輸入錯誤的存在,影響所采集信息的可靠性。而自動識別輸入技術,大大提高了物流信息采集的工作效率。RFID技術的應用是其它技術識別技術,如條碼、IC卡、光卡等無法企及的,如:讀取方便快捷、識別速度快、數據容量大、使用壽命長、應用范圍廣、標簽數據可動態(tài)更改、安全性強、動態(tài)實時通信等。和傳統(tǒng)條形碼識別技術相比,RFID有以下優(yōu)勢:
?、倏焖賿呙?;
?、隗w積小型化、形狀多樣化。RFID在讀取上不受尺寸大小與形狀限制;
③抗污染能力和耐久性。RFID對水、油和化學藥品等物質有強抵抗性;
?、芸芍貜褪褂?。條碼印刷后無法更改,RFID標簽內存儲的數據可以方便的更新。
⑤穿透性和無屏障閱讀。電磁波能穿透的介質,對RFID的識別都不會產生影響;
?、迶祿挠洃浫萘看螅?br /> ?、甙踩浴=涍^加密的RFID數據,被竊取后被攻擊者讀出、復制的可能性很小。
2RFID身份識別系統(tǒng)的設計與實現(xiàn)
2.1電子標簽的設計
在本系統(tǒng)中,我們選擇TI公司的CCS511做為電子標簽[6],TI公司的CC2511是為無線通信應用設計的低功耗2.4GHz的SoC芯片,CC2511集成了TI公司研發(fā)的被稱為業(yè)界最佳的RF收發(fā)器,其實芯片特性如下:主處理器:增加8051;存儲單元:32kBFLASH用于數據和程序的存儲,4kB數據空間;安全組件:支持AES對稱算法;接口支持:支持USB2.0協(xié)議全速率12Mb/s工作模式;功耗:最低功耗模式下電流為300nA;射頻:頻率范圍從2400~2483.5MHz可自由調節(jié)。
2.1.1存儲數據防靜態(tài)分析設計
為保障存儲器中數據的安全,在設計中我們使用CC2511中的AES模塊對數據進行加密后再存儲,密鑰存儲于CC2511的片內數據區(qū)中中,在芯片第一次上電時隨機生成,不可讀出,這樣保證了存儲在EEPROM中數據的靜態(tài)安全性。此外,為防止硬件上的安全隱患,即EEPROM被人為替換。我們采取CC2511與EEPROM的ID號匹配認證的方式,以實現(xiàn)兩個芯片的一一對應。具體的匹配流程如圖2所示。
評論